This book reads like a novel but is based on Gordon McDonald’s own experience of seeing a church through a process of change. When one member of the church asked the question, “Who stole my church?”, he was prompted to bring together a group of people who felt uneasy about the changes that were being introduced. The book is a record of the discussions, thoughts and feelings they shared together.
This book will leave the reader at times engulfed in laughter, at times deeply moved, and probably, with a whole different view about the kind of change that God is really looking for in his church.

Chris Hollies is an independent Church Development Consultant and Trainer who is committed to the local church, with a desire to see her become all that God would have her be.

He offers over 9 years of experience in church consulting and training having worked with churches and their leaders from across the denominational spectrum, particularly in Northern Ireland where he and his wife and 3 daughters live. He has worked with the Presbyterian, Church of Ireland, Church of Scotland, Baptist, Methodist, and Elim denominations together with many independent churches.

Change can be a frightening thing and if we are going to be able to move forward, careful thought and guidance is needed.
The author of The Challenge of Change offers a map for healthy change in the local church. Writing as a pastor and practitioner, Phil Potter explains ways of shaping change of any kind in the life of a church and presents a guide to understanding the changing shape of church, including the ‘fresh expressions’ of church now emerging. He uses his experiences of leading his own church through five major transition periods, with his own mistakes and personal stories as examples to illustrate his points.

This book doesn’t confine itself to conventional ideas of teams, but takes a much broader look at teamwork and working together. Readers will find the contents applicable to many areas of life including marriage and family life, friendships, school, university, the workplace, and the local church. It would also be particularly relevant to people involved with overseas mission teams.
